Do we really need another social networking site?

The other day, I wrote an article about a new social media platform called Jaspud.com. After I was done publishing it on Digital Journal, I asked myself the following question: Do we really need another network to connect with people?

I have grown tired of Facebook. While I love the fact that the platform allows me to showcase what I do through my Fan Page, I honestly find that the social network has become unreliable. Too many changes occur too often. You never know what will happen next, and for someone like me, who does everything on their own, it is annoying to have to spend hours figuring out any new change.
